Didn't someone say before that they didn't use her normal hair because it was too 'thin' or not 'full' enough? I don't see how they could think that because in this picture her hair looks lovely and quite full of body.

Yep, that was the reasoning.

The trouble with hair like Kate's (and for that matter, like Jeri's, and mine... :p ) is that it's too fine to hold a 'do for any length of time. They'd have to seriously work on her hair before every scene to keep it consistent throughout the episode.

BTW, as much as Kate hated the wig, it saved her natural hair from too much abuse. The heat of blowdryers and electric rollers on top of coloring it is seriously damaging to fine hair.

You can really see the damage to Jeri's hair in "Natural Law" when the updo comes down.
